I love the range of homewares, games, and collaborations it has, and there is a great range of price points.There is something comforting about buying books and gifts at, especially during the holidays. It’s a New York institution, and whatever you buy there, be it a current best-seller or a rare first edition, it feels like you’re investing in keeping a classic alive. At the same time, you’re giving a gift that comes from somewhere very real, somewhere with its own story.

And finally, a stop for myself: the Village Ewe for a needlepoint canvas and thread to pass the time on a flight or in front of the fire.is one of my favorite shops in New York, holiday season or not. It’s one of the only places I can find gifts for everyone on my list: handmade jewelry for my sister, ceramics and beautiful bath products for my mom, and groovy T-shirts or Warm sweats for my boyfriend.
